Red Light Therapy: Feed Your Mitochondria

We evolved under the full spectrum of sunlight, but we live under artificial blue lights. Red Light Therapy (RLT) involves exposing your skin to specific wavelengths of red and near-infrared light. This light penetrates the skin and stimulates the mitochondria (the power plants of your cells) to produce more ATP energy. It reduces inflammation, improves skin health, and speeds up recovery. Sitting in front of a red light panel for 10 minutes a day is like photosynthesis for humans—pure cellular energy.
